The City of Edmonton selected Marigold Infrastructure Partners to design and build the 14-kilometre Valley Line West LRT project from downtown to Lewis Farms. Construction began in 2021. Marigold is a design-build joint venture agreement between Parsons and Colas.
Responsibilities:
- Review construction performance to ensure the early identification of variances and corrective action.
- Ensure early identification and documentation of non-conformities through regular surveillance audits, site walk downs and other forms of Quality Control activities.
- Support external ISO 9001 registration and assessment audit programs
- Hold project team accountable for quality control program requirements and the overall Quality Manual.
- Perform regular surveillance audits to ensure adherence to the ITP program.
- Ensure understanding of the code and specification requirements applicable to the specific scope of work.
- Perform internal and external audits in line with the ISO 9001 standard and the Project Audit Schedule, as assigned.
- Monitor and evaluate the subcontractors' performance and report to the Quality Manager
- Verify project requirements are specified to vendors and contractor documentation submittals.
- Review the material receiving process to ensure all received materials are in conformance with the approved submittal, stored and handled appropriately.
- May attend pre-bid meetings and coordinate project requirements.
- Follow up status of issued non-conformance reports.
- Monitor the progress and effectiveness of the project quality management system.
- Recommend and implement improvements when required.
